Every time we "replay" a memory, we replace the original memory with a slightly modified version. researchers call this _____.

The correct answer is memory reconsolidation.

Memory reconsolidation refers to a process whereby memories can be accessed, recoded and modified to change the information in them. It is used as a form of therapy where clients who have undergone traumatic events can have their memories of the events modified so that they are less distressful and painful when recalled.
